Reporting directly to the General Manager, the Head Chef will lead the kitchen team in delivering high quality food and memorable dining experiences for our guests. This is an exciting opportunity for a creative, commercially minded chef who enjoys working in a fast paced city centre hotel and takes pride in developing seasonal menus, leading a successful team and consistently delivering excellent food and service.
- Lead the daily operations of the kitchen team, ensuring the highest standards of food quality, presentation, consistency, and service excellence.
- Support menu development and culinary innovation while maintaining Novotel brand standards and incorporating local influences.
- Inspire, coach, and develop chefs and colleagues through effective leadership, training, and mentorship.
- Ensure compliance with all food safety, HACCP, and hygiene standards.
- Monitor food preparation, production, and service standards across all culinary outlets.
- Collaborate with senior leadership team team to enhance the overall guest experience.
- Maintain strong relationships with suppliers and support effective procurement practices.
- Minimum 3 years experience in a senior commercial kitchen role
- Strong leadership skills with a hands on approach
- Solid knowledge of food safety and kitchen operations
- Flexibility to work evenings and weekends
